Sorry if this question has been asked before, Had a quick look but couldn\'t find much on it.
So I am in the process of dropping a new mac-daddy forged closed deck engine in my V5 Sti. The problem I have noticed is that the block has a 4 bolt bell-housing and the gearbox has the 8 bolt assembly. (from what i have read they changed to the 8 bolt from the V5) Am i going to need a 4 bolt gearbox or can i get away with the existing 8 bolt one in some way?
